Martha and Hilda metal print by Bruce Dumas.   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

Artist Bruce Dumas is a native of New England, and has been painting professionally since 1982. His love for art began as a child, as he began sketching and drawing. Originally pursuing Fantasy and Science Fiction images, he then began creating landscape paintings, and soon after depicting wildlife subjects in their environment. Previously, Dumas painted in oils, but now works exclusively with acrylics on canvas and board, representing the wide variety of nature, landscapes, seascapes, and harbor scenes encountered on his extensive field trips throughout New England and along the east coast.
